A TIME

There comes a time
  in each man's life
    when that decisions hard are made.
There comes a time
  in each man's life
    when that man is afraid.

A space in time
  of aimless kind
    a searching of our own.
A touching care
  a searching stare
    a feeling all have known.

There comes a time
  for each and all
    to wonder at the sky.
There comes a time
  when love we find
    and softly kiss goodbye.


     DanielJ.Burt
3/76 (all rights reserved)
